Tebhapadar is a village of Birmaharajpur subdivision of Subarnapur district of Odisha, India.[1][2][3] It is located on the bank of Surubalijora and Mahanadi River.[4] Total population of this village is 1,326 out of which 697 are male and 629 are female.[5] This village is spread over 755.673 acres (3.05810 km2) of land.[6]

This village is located on side of the main road that connects Rairakhol to Sambalpur via Birmaharajpur. The neighboring villages are Ambasarabhata, Buromala, and Pitamahul.[7]
